ORN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2023 in Review

76 of the 6,859 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Orion Group Holdings (ORN) for Q4 2023, worth a combined $110M — down 4.4% from $115M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 14 funds opened new ORN positions and 7 closed out — a net gain of 7 holders — while 25 added to existing stakes and 21 trimmed.

The largest buyer was G2 Investment Partners Management, adding an estimated $2.08M. The largest seller was EAM Investors, exiting entirely with an estimated $2.31M sold.
